The Chevrolet repair market in and around Arlington, Iowa, is characterized by a reliance on reputable, long-standing local shops in neighboring commercial hubs like Oelwein, Waterloo, and Cedar Falls. As a small town, Arlington itself does not host a dedicated Chevrolet specialist, forcing residents to travel short distances for specialized service. The market competition is moderate, with a handful of established providers dominating the reputation space. These shops are typically family-owned, have been operating for decades, and build their clientele through strong word-of-mouth and proven reliability. Pricing is generally competitive and often considered fair for the region, reflecting the local economy, with labor rates typically lower than at a metropolitan-area dealership while still offering expert-level knowledge. For highly complex issues, particularly with newer models or performance vehicles like the Corvette, residents may need to travel to the larger Cedar Falls/Waterloo area for the most advanced diagnostic capabilities.
